1. An optical imaging system, comprising:
a first lens comprising a refractive power;
a second lens comprising a refractive power;
a third lens comprising a convex object-side surface and a concave image-side surface in a paraxial region;
a fourth lens comprising a convex object-side surface and a concave image-side surface in a paraxial region;
a fifth lens comprising a convex image-side surface; and
a sixth lens comprising negative refractive power, and a concave object-side surface in a paraxial region,
wherein the first to sixth lenses are sequentially disposed in ascending numerical order from an object side of the optical imaging system toward an imaging plane of the optical imaging system,
wherein an absolute value of a curvature of the object-side surface of the second lens is greater than an absolute value of a curvature of an image-side surface of the first lens,
wherein a thickness of the fifth lens is greater than a thickness of the sixth lens, and
wherein an Abbe number of the third lens is 50 or greater.
